Some FAQ’s we get asked

How do Bell & Bone Cat Dental Bites help with dental health in cats?

Our bites contain Zinc, Ascophyllum Nodosum, and Vitamin C, which reduce plaque naturally. They also include a fibre called Cellulose, creating a chewy texture, helping to scrape off plaque and tartar build up.

What are the signs of dental disease in cats?

Look for bad breath, yellowing teeth, and difficulty eating. Drooling, pawing at the mouth, and head shaking are also common signs of dental disease in cats. If your cat shows these signs, we recommend consulting your vet and starting your cat on an at-home, daily dental care routine.

How often should I give my cat dental bites?

For best results, give your cat our dental bites once daily to maintain healthy teeth and gums. Make sure to read the feeding guide on the back of the pack for optimal results.

Can dental disease affect my cat’s overall health?

Yes, poor dental hygiene can lead to infections that affect your cat’s heart, kidneys, and general well-being.

What age is best to start using Cat Dental Bites?

Our Cat Dental Bites are suitable for cats from 6 months old. Due to the active ingredients and chewy nature of the bites, it is important that kitten teeth have fallen out and adult teeth have come through.
